    Tyson Fury wins the World Heavyweight Championship



    Ratings updated:

    https://boxranks.wordpress.com/2015/...december-2015/




    HEAVYWEIGHT:


    Tyson Fury (25-0, 18 KOs) previously third climbs to the top of the mountain by winning a twelve round unanimous decision over defending Champion Wladimir Klitschko (64-4, 53 KOs). Klitschko is now rated number one. Alexander Povetkin (30-1, 22 KOs) and Deontay Wilder (35-0, 34 KOs) shuffle down a place each to second and third respectively. Number eight Carlos Takam (33-2-1, 25 KOs) won a eight round unanimous decision over unrated journeyman George Arias (56-15, 42 KOs).

    LIGHT-HEAVYWEIGHT:

    Eleider Alvarez (19-0, 10 KOs) previously eighth switches places with Isaac Chilemba (24-3-2, 10 KOs) after winning a close twelve round majority decision over the South African.

    SUPER-MIDDLEWEIGHT:

    James Degale (22-1, 14 KOs) advances from second to first after winning a close hard fought twelve round unanimous decision over determined fringe contender Lucian Bute (32-3, 25 KOs) in a fantastic fight. Arthur Abraham (44-4, 29 KOs) drops from first to second.

    SUPER-WELTERWEIGHT:

    Number two Erislandy Lara (22-2-2, 13 KOs) destroyed unrated Jan Zaveck (35-4, 19 KOs) in the three rounds. Number five Jermall Charlo (23-0, 18 KOs) scored a fourth round stoppage over unrated Wilky Campfort (21-2, 12 KOs). No changes.

    LIGHTWEIGHT:


    Yuriorkis Gamboa (24-1, 17 KOs) is scheduled to fight on December 19. Although Gamboa had scheduled this bout within the given time-frames his inactivity occurred during a crucial period within the division when others were making their moves. Gamboa slides from fourth to seventh. Denis Shafikov (36-1-1, 19 KOs), Jorge Linares (40-3, 27 KOs) and Terry Flanagan (29-0, 12 KOs) all advance a place each to fourth, fifth and sixth respectively.

    FEATHERWEIGHT:

    Number eight Simpiwe Vetyeka (28-3, 17 KOs) shock of some ring rust with a fourth round knockout over unrated Rodolfo Puente (16-2-2, 12 KOs). No changes.

    SUPER-FLYWEIGHT:

    Number two Carlos Caudras (34-0-1, 26 KOs) won a twelve round unanimous decision over unrated Koki Eto (17-4-1, 13 KOs). Number eight Arthur Villanueva (28-1, 14 KOs) won a twelve round split decision over unrated Victor Mendez (19-3-2, 15 KOs). No changes.

    FLYWEIGHT:

    Last week’s number five Moruti Mthalane (31-2, 20 KOs) exits due to inactivity. Everyone rated six through ten moves up a notch each. Felix Alvarado (21-2, 18 KOs) enters at number ten.

    LIGHT-FLYWEIGHT:

    Yu Kimura (18-2-1, 3 KOs) crashes the ratings at number five after upsetting previous number two Pedro Guevara (26-2-1, 17 KOs) by twelve round split decision. Guevara plummets to sixth. Paipharob Kokietgym (32-0, 25 KOs), Javier Mendoza (24-2-1, 19 KOs) and Ryoichi Taguchi (22-2-1, 9 KOs) all move up a place each to second, third and fourth respectively, whilst everyone rated six through nine last week drops a place. Last week’s number ten Ganigan Lopez (26-6, 17 KOs) exits. Milan Melindo (33-2, 12 KOs) now number ten won a ten round split decision over unrated Victor Emanuel Olivo (9-1, 4 KOs) in a Flyweight bout.

    MINIMUMWEIGHT:

    Number three Wanheng Menayothin (40-0, 15 KOs) scored a ninth round stoppage over unrated Young Gil Bae (26-5-1, 21 KOs). No changes.

    Danny Jacobs blasts his way into the Middleweight mix.



    Ratings updated:

    https://boxranks.wordpress.com/2015/...december-2015/



    HEAVYWEIGHT:

    Number four Kubrat Pulev (22-1, 12 KOs) stayed busy against unrated journeyman Maurice Harris (26-21-3, 11 KOs) with a first round KO. No changes.

    MIDDLEWEIGHT:

    Daniel Jacobs (31-1, 28 KOs) rockets from ninth to third after destroying last week’s number three Peter Quillin (32-1-1, 23 KOs) in one round. Quillin falls to fifth. Everyone rated five through eight previously drops a spot each.

    FEATHERWEIGHT:

    Jesus Marcelo Andres Cueller (28-1, 21 KOs) advances from tenth to ninth with a twelve round unanimous decision over fringe contender Jonathan Oquendo (26-5, 16 KOs). Inactive Robinson Castellanos (21-10, 13 KOs) slips a spot to tenth.

    FLYWEIGHT:

    Number two Amnat Ruenroeng (17-0, 5 KOs) won a twelve round unanimous decision over unrated Myung Ho Lee (19-5-1, 6 KOs). No changes.

    LIGHT-FLYWEIGHT:

    Number eight Flyweight Moises Fuentes (23-2-1, 12 KOs) enters at sixth after winning a hard fought twelve round split decision over fellow contender Francisco Rodriguez Jr (17-4-1, 11 KOs). Pedro Guevara (26-2-1, 17 KOs) and Rodriguez Jr move down a place each to seventh and eighth respectively. Alberto Rossel (34-9, 13 KOs) previously eighth exits as he is campaigning at Flyweight.

    Nonito Donaire fought his way to victory in a ferocious battle.



    Ratings updated:

    https://boxranks.wordpress.com/2015/...december-2015/



    LIGHTWEIGHT:

    Ismael Barroso (19-0-2, 18 KOs) enters at number eight after stopping previous number eight Kevin Mitchell (39-4, 29 KOs) in five rounds. Mitchell exits. Sharif Bogere (27-1, 19 KOs) drops a place from eighth to ninth.

    SUPER-BANTAMWEIGHT:

    Number three Nonito Donaire (36-3, 23 KOs) won a brutal twelve round unanimous decision in a war against fringe contender Cesar Juarez (17-4, 13 KOs). No changes.

    FLYWEIGHT:

    Moruti Mthalane (32-2, 21 KOs) is back in the ratings at number five after returning to the ring for the first time in over a year with a ninth round stoppage over unrated Renz Rosia (12-4, 6 KOs). Everyone rated five through nine last time drops a spot. Previous number ten Felix Alvarado (21-2, 18 KOs) is pushed out for now.
